A man abandons his environment to occupy a wooden house built in Nave 10 and to turn into an aesthetic fact the relationship that he strikes up with strangers.
During five days in a row, he will converse, write, and live in his new habitatin full view of the public. This man will be the actor Juan Loriente, a collaborator with and fetish actor of Rodrigo Garcia since 1999. During his career, he has worked with artists such as La Ribot, Ana Vallés, Carlos Marquerie or La Fura dels Baus.
This durational performance art piece by director, playwright and visual artist Fernando Rubio premièred in 2015 in Parque de la Memoria in Buenos Aires within the framework of the BP15 Performances Biennial. It was also presented in Santiago a Mil Festival in Santiago (Chile), in Singapore International Festival of Arts, and in Theater der Welt Festival (Germany). It is the second part of the trilogy of works that begins with When we Were Kids and ends with And Everything Else.

MORE ABOUT THE TIME BETWEEN US The Russian artist Ilya Kabakov said on one occasion: “In this way, a house is a device of one’s memory, it evokes memories, it calls up ghostly entities. The unconscious is also populated by ghosts. Not only memories, but also things we have forgotten are “stored” there. The soul is a dwelling place. Remembering houses and rooms we learn to look within ourselves”. To carry out his work, Rubio takes his inspiration from and delves further into this reflection.
“I seek to redefine the space in which we find ourselves to establish new affections between people we know and people we don’t know. The work delves into our habits and transformations through the action of leaving the place we are accustomed to in order to rethink our bonds to our surroundings and to live in an ever-changing way, in the days, hours, relationships, space. At the same time, the spatial object, the house, decentralised from the common places of locations in cities, reflects and creates a crisis in the physical and symbolic place that we inhabit”, Fernando Rubio.
